Route into Castletown to be closed for “critical” gas works

by isleofman.com 12th January 2012

MANX Gas will close Alexandra Road in Castletown next week to carry out natural gas conversion work.

 

The road will be closed between S&S Motors and the traffic lights at Castletown Corner from Monday, January 16.

 

Engineering manager Robert Gardner said: "A critical phase has now been reached and the final connection to the south area of the Island.

 

"In order to carry out the crossing of the railway line at Alexandra Road and connect to the existing gas mains we will, unfortunately, have to close Alexandra Road."

 

The road will be closed between 9am and 4pm each day and the work is expected to be finished by January 23.

 

Mr Gardner continued: "Manx Gas will however keep the public informed of any amendments to this possible completion date.

 

"We apologise for any inconvenience caused and will make every effort to complete these works as quickly as possible but in a safe manner."
